Dennis Lehane's previous thrillers Mystic River (2001) and Shutter Island (2003) were best-sellers and much talked about books. The Given Day (2008) is an exploration of a rich cast of characters involved in stressed situations in Boston at the end of the First World War. It was a time of upheaval and calamity, and what Lehane does is take us inside his fictional world. The famous baseball player Babe Ruth features in this memorable story. Compared to E L Doctorow for its literary play with real historical figures it is Lehane's most mature novel. Lee Child does a brilliant job is setting out for us Dennis Lehane's journey as a writer in his appreciation for this edition. H e asks the worrying question has Dennis left crime writing behind?
This signed limited is one of only 80 numbered copies, produced by arrangement with Transworld. It is bound in leather with marbled paper over boards and coloured top edge. It is a heavy volume with 704 pp. Still a landmark book for Lehane.
